Crash-Report Pipeline: Stalled Ingestion (Marlowe App)

If crash reports from the Marlowe mobile app stop appearing in the Tidepool dashboard, first check the ingest workers on the Bramley cluster. A stalled worker usually means the symbolication cache is full; clear it with the standard flush job and restart the pool. Reports queue safely for up to six hours, so no data is lost. Confirm recovery by watching the backlog counter drop. When filing the incident ticket, include the trace token shown below.

trace token, fafog-kageg: htk4_98e6

Subject: DR drill next Thursday — GpuScope edition

Hey newcomers! We're running our quarterly disaster-recovery drill on the GpuScope memory-profiling stack. We'll simulate losing the profiler ingest node and restore from the Varnholt cold snapshot. Nothing scary — just follow the runbook and ask Priya in #gpuscope-drill if stuck. To unlock the restore vault during the drill, use the passphrase below.

vault phrase of yawig-bawig = fenael-norael-eliox-gilox-casath-druath-zorys-istwyn-jorwyn

Handover: SnackRoute restock planner. Cron runs at 04:00, pulls stock levels from the KioskSync feed, outputs routes for the Brindleport depot. Known issue: stale telemetry from older Vendomat units — planner falls back to last-known counts. Don't touch the weighting config without testing against the replay harness. Deploy via the usual pipeline, staging first. If anything breaks overnight, escalate directly to the on-call owner.

named custodian: Brivan Eliath Quenox Frador